
Lonzo Ball is expected to be the type of transcendent talent to turn around a Los Angeles Lakers franchise that has endured its share of losing seasons recently. He has the ability to do it all from the point guard spot and the Lakers know it too as they took him with the second overall pick in this summer’s NBA Draft.
However, along with the attention Ball has garnered on the court, the 20-year-old has also started to make serious waves in the entertainment industry, specifically in the rap world. He first claimed 21 Savage had a better album this summer than Jay-Z and also called Migos and Future real hip-hop, simultaneously disrespecting rap legend Nas.
Not only does Lonzo Ball have strong opinions on hip-hop but he has spit a few bars of his own in the past, curating a remix to Drake’s Free Smoke months ago. Now, the oldest of the three Ball brothers going by the rap name ‘Zo’ has officially released his debut single ‘Melo Ball 1’.
The track’s title is related to his little brother, LaMelo, getting his own Big Baller Brand shoe similar to Lonzo called the Melo Ball 1. The track features Kenneth Paige on the hook while Lonzo raps his two verses about Big Baller Brand and his youngest brother over the trap-inspired beat.
